Low-power wireless technology used for electronic shelf label system
14 July 2004
News
Zarlink Semiconductor is supplying an ultra low-power wireless chip designed specifically for ESL (electronic shelf label) systems to Swedish-based Pricer, a leading designer of retail electronic price and information technology.
Pricer was recently awarded a major contract by France-based supermarket chain Carrefour. A Pricer ESL system ranges from a few hundred electronic shelf labels for a small store to 70 000 labels for a large wholesale location. Each label includes a Zarlink ultra low-power wireless SoC (system-on-chip).
Pricer's ESL system includes electronic shelf labels wirelessly connected to a central pricing system via Zarlink's ultra low-powered SoC. When the retailer changes the price of an item, the new pricing information is simultaneously transmitted to the electronic label and the cash register to ensure complete price integrity.
Zarlink is providing Pricer with an SoC electronic label solution that combines several functions - a wireless receiver and transmitter, liquid crystal display driver, memory and more.
